JDRF is pleased to offer additional services to the diabetes community via its partnership with Fit4D. Fit4D provides integrated Fitness and Nutritional Coaching to people with diabetes, coordinated with their physicians, to enable them to gain better control of their Blood Glucose levels and overall health. In addition, Fit4D offers the support and motivation typically available only from a personal coach.
The Fit4D coaching team includes nurses, exercise physiologists, registered dietitians and personal trainers - who have diabetes expertise and Certified Diabetes Educator (CDE) accreditation.
Fit4D also hosts regular FREE Web/Phone Seminars as an education service to the diabetes community. Presentations are followed by a question and answer segment led by Fit4D coaches.
